Sooner or later, it's gotta be done - clean the touch screen...what to use...?
I use these things - they contain the recommended isopropyl alcohol, and are a very soft pad. They come in a box of 100 pads, and cost less than $3. I also use them to clean my glasses, as well as for the purpose that they were designed. Handy to have around...

I use Klear Screen on a clean microfiber cloth. I also use that to clean the screen of my Palm and all the LCDs in the house. If I don't have Klear Screen handy, I use plain water.

A homebrew of 1/2 water and 1/2 70% alcohol and a microfiber cloth...you can buy a little 2 oz spray bottle in most drug stores and the mix last a LONG time
